For this field trip we’ll be exploring the Pawnee National Grasslands, Crow Valley Campground and the town of Briggsdale. We’ll start in Briggsdale to look for Mountain Plover and the drive the Pawnee Grasslands auto tour looking for grassland birds like the Thick-billed and Chestnut-collared Longspur. We’ll stop for lunch and do some birding the Crow Valley Campground to look for migrants. We’ll do some birding on foot, mainly at the Crow Valley Campground. In other areas will be in and out of vehicles birding along the road.
